Output 3dd7a19fb939dc98699b53647a41ae8f90fe33f94864260d0814c75118393a00:10

value
39630000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c938627651f4ec69333807e3eac7fbae56abf195 OP_EQUALVERIFY OP_CHECKSIG
address
1KLxNELDJ37sSm4VtcwpywY1QmM76Y2kkM
transaction
3dd7a19fb939dc98699b53647a41ae8f90fe33f94864260d0814c75118393a00
spent
true